Begin your adventure in Manali, a picturesque hill station nestled in the Himalayas. In the morning, embark on a thrilling rafting expedition in the Beas River, surrounded by breathtaking mountain views. After a thrilling morning, head to Solang Valley in the afternoon for exciting activities like paragliding and zorbing. Wrap up the day by exploring Manali Mall Road in the evening, known for its shops, cafes, and lively atmosphere.
On this day, set off on an unforgettable journey to Rohtang Pass, located at an altitude of 3,978 meters. Marvel at the stunning snow-capped peaks, breathtaking landscapes, and cascading waterfalls. Engage in thrilling activities like skiing and snowboarding (depending on weather conditions) or simply enjoy the scenic beauty. Return to Manali in the evening and spend the rest of the day at leisure.
Today, leave Manali and make your way to Shimla, the former summer capital of British India. Upon reaching Shimla, take a thrilling trek to Jakhu Temple, located atop Jakhu Hill. En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ding mountains and spot playful monkeys. In the afternoon, explore the Mall Road of Shimla, known for its shops and vibrant atmosphere. In the evening, indulge in an exhilarating ice-skating session at the historic Shimla Ice Skating Rink.
Today, embark on a thrilling adventure in Kufri, a small hill station located near Shimla. Enjoy horse riding through the scenic valleys and trek through the picturesque trails. Visit the Himalayan Nature Park, home to various species of animals and birds. Experience the excitement of yak rides and capture memorable photographs with these gentle creatures. Return to Shimla in the evening for relaxation.
Embark on an exciting day trip from Shimla to Mashobra and Narkanda. In Mashobra, indulge in thrilling activities like rappelling and rock climbing. Immerse yourself in the serene beauty of the surroundings by taking a nature walk or a jungle hike. Later, proceed to Narkanda, a popular ski resort. Experience the thrill of skiing or enjoy stunning views of the Himalayas. Return to Shimla in the evening.
Say goodbye to the enchanting hills of Manali and Shimla as you depart on this day. Take some time to explore the remaining attractions in Shimla, such as the Viceregal Lodge and Himachal State Museum, if time allows. Depart for your next destination with unforgettable memories of your thrilling adventure in Manali and Shimla.
For adventure enthusiasts seeking off the beaten path attractions, consider visiting Chail, a serene hill station near Shimla. Engage in adventure activities like trekking and river rafting, and explore the Chail Wildlife Sanctuary for a glimpse of the local flora and fauna. Don't miss the beautiful Kali Ka Tibba temple, offering panoramic views of the Himalayas. Another lesser-known gem is the Barot Valley near Mandi, where you can enjoy camping, trout fishing, and lovely waterfall hikes.
